As the recession continues to an unforeseen end, one retailer has continued to grow and boast of successful results despite waning consumer demand on the high street. Uniqlo, the global fashion retailer owned by Fast Retailing in Japan, has become one of the success stories of the economic downturn, known for its marketing innovations as much as its quality basic clothing.
